Over 100 accidents were reported due to the traffic violation of jumping red signal in Dubai. One death and 127 injured were reported in these accidents in 2017, according to Brigadier Saif Muhair Al Mazrouei, director-general of General Department of Traffic at the Dubai Police.
"Jumping the red signal is considered one of the most serious violations as accidents resulting from this violation often cause death or serious injuries. While 100 road accidents were reported last year, this January saw six road accidents resulting in the injury of four people."
Brig Mazrouei pointed out that jumping the red signal always lead to collisions with vehicles coming from other directions, often opposite or perpendicular.
"Drivers usually increase speed while approaching the traffic lights so they can cross before it turns red. They overlook moving cars on other sides."
Brig Mazrouei said the fine for jumping red signal is Dh1,000 and 12 black points will be added to the driver's licence, and the car will be confiscated for 30 days. The fine for heavy vehicles for the same violation is Dh3,000 with their license suspended for one year.
